The Last Kiss

***1/2 Stars

"We all make choices. What's your's?"

The Last Kiss is a painfully honest look at how years of love and sacrifice can be destroyed by 30 seconds of lies and deception. Writer Paul Haggis, who gave us "Crash" and "Million Dollar Baby" explores another important issue about life...relationships.

Michael, (Garden State and Scrub's Zach Braff) a 29 year old architect is struggling to adapt to adulthood. His best friends are still close, his career is blossoming, and his girlfriend Jenna (Jacinda Barrett) is one of kind. She becomes pregnant and soon the two will live hapily ever after...right?

Scared and confused, Michael begins to question whether or not his life is what he wants it to be. He meets this girl Kim (Rachel Bilson), a young college girl who is instantly attracted to Michael. He begins to question whether or not he is ready to grow up. In this case, growing up for Michael will not be easy.

Life is what you make of it. The choice you make at one moment can alter your future. The Last Kiss is a perfect instrument of that. It shows, that in a realistic world, that not all relationships are perfect. Sometimes you have to forgive and forget.
